The devotional music group Aradhna, led by Chris Hale and Pete Hicks, recorded this bhajan as the title track for their first album, released in 2000. This is a new take on the song, with a variation on the chorus melody and some new chord changes, which depart somewhat from the original version that they did. Aradhna originally learned their version of Deep Jale in 1995 from an album called Naman released on cassette by Matridham Ashram, Varanasi. It featured the songs and voice of Fr. Anil Dev, the gentle spiritual leader of the Ashram who is also a prolific composer of Yeshu Bhajans. - M.S.
lyrics
दीप जले प्रभु नाम रहे
Deepa jale Prabhu naama rahe
Light the lamp for the name of the Lord to remain
मेरे मंदिर में, मंदिर में
Mere mandira mein, mandira mein
In my temple, in my temple (of the heart)
1. साँझ-सवेरे यह मन गाये
Saanjha savere yeh mana gaaye
Evening and morning my soul will sing
येशु तेरा नाम, प्रभु येशु तेरा नाम
Yeshu tera naam, Prabhu Yeshu tera naam
Jesus’ your name, Lord Jesus your name
नाम रहे मन में
Naama rahe mana mein
May your name remain in my heart
प्रभु नाम रहे मन में
Prabhu naama rahe mana mein
Lord may your name remain in my heart
2. दीप जलाये राह निहारूं
Deepa jalaaye raaha nihaarun
I am lighting the lamp and watching the road
दर्शन को, प्रभु दर्शन को
Darashana ko, Prabhu darashana ko
For a vision, a vision of the Lord
आन बसो दिल में
Aan baso dila mein
Come dwell in my heart
प्रभु आन बसो दिल में
Prabhu aana baso dila mein
Lord, come dwell in my heart
3. हे प्रभु दाता विश्व-विधाता
He Prabhu daata Vishwa-vidhaata
Oh Generous Lord, Creator of the whole universe
नमन करूँ प्रभु नमन करूँ
Namana karun Prabhu namana karun
I bow before you, Lord I bow before you
राग जगे मन में
Raaga jage mana mein
Let desire awaken in my soul
अनुराग जगे मन में
Anuraaga jage mana mein
Let passion awaken in my soul
Song No. 20 from the Kshama Sagar Bhakti Mala (Songbook)
